    2021 yukon xl getting new rear end at 60K miles

    The service manager told me these difs are not easily serviceable and they would need to purchase special tools to work on it. He said it would be cheaper to just replace the whole unit than it would be to buy the tools and then repair whatever is wrong. The paperwork says it was the front...

    2021 yukon xl getting new rear end at 60K miles

    Picked it up today and all is well. Annoying howl noise is gone! They replaced the rear dif and either ate the cost or worked something out with GM. They said it was about a $4500 repair and asked me to pay $500 which I gladly did. Class act all around I definitely will be buying my next GM...
